Output 121d5072aefc8fa0a4cee6145c9ff06ed38d6a2524bfb81b3179d8b327bd0341:0

value
49899774000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ba2f0475b554d8e581ac96cee85d295079dbecb OP_EQUALVERIFY OP_CHECKSIG
address
DHsRf6S8FMTd6p1EW5vS44Vr3WQ6Gj3Q9L
transaction
121d5072aefc8fa0a4cee6145c9ff06ed38d6a2524bfb81b3179d8b327bd0341